The use of X-ray Diffraction and Scattering in Characterization of Polymer Structure

Source

X-ray diffraction studies provide useful information about the internal arrangement of polymer molecules—an important factor affecting the physical properties of plastics. Such studies also help to explain the mechanism by which this molecular arrangement affects properties. Therefore, X-ray diffraction studies are important from both a practical and a fundamental viewpoint.
